servicestack,setup-project,Razor,Windows Services,servicestack,Setup Project" /> servicestack,setup-project,Razor,Windows Services,servicestack,Setup Project" />

ServiceStack作为带有Razor的Windows服务-安装项目

ServiceStack作为带有Razor的Windows服务-安装项目,razor,windows-services,servicestack,setup-project,Razor,Windows Services,servicestack,Setup Project,我有一个使用razor的servicestack项目通过windows服务公开,需要创建一个安装项目来安装它(与我看到的演示中的批处理文件相反) 关于如何通过打包的安装项目实现这一点,有什么建议吗?查看安装windows服务文件的文件夹,它只有dll,没有razor视图。。。所以我解决了这些问题,现在我看到了: 不确定为什么会出现此错误,是否可以再次检查部署的是源文件,而不是临时版本 否则,托管Razor的其他一些选项是将它们更改为嵌入式资源,这样原始源文件就会编译到.dll中,因此您不需要将它

我有一个使用razor的servicestack项目通过windows服务公开,需要创建一个安装项目来安装它(与我看到的演示中的批处理文件相反)

关于如何通过打包的安装项目实现这一点,有什么建议吗?查看安装windows服务文件的文件夹,它只有dll,没有razor视图。。。所以我解决了这些问题,现在我看到了:


不确定为什么会出现此错误,是否可以再次检查部署的是源文件,而不是临时版本

否则,托管Razor的其他一些选项是将它们更改为嵌入式资源,这样原始源文件就会编译到.dll中,因此您不需要将它们部署到项目中


也可以通过这种方式将实现编译到.dll中。

预编译工作正常。我认为这个问题与我的项目名称中有“ServiceStack”(与razor视图编译代码混淆)或在特定域用户(非本地系统)下运行windows服务有关